Daphne du Maurier enthralls and enchants me again. This book is less foreboding than others but is still wonderful. What is not to love about French pirates wooing an English woman and then allowing her to live a moment as a pirate herself? What is not to love about beautifully written prose and a very feminist slant? There is very little about which to complain in any of du Maurier's books. I have now read 8 of them and am on the hunt to find her others. ...more

DuMaurier has the absolute talent of writing characters who are assholes and yet also very compelling. Dona St Columb, on the face of it, is an awful person - I would despise her if I knew her irl - but I couldn’t help being charmed by her in this story. I felt so anxious for her, I wanted everything to work out for her. That created a lot of inner conflict for me, because Dona was not a good person, so why was I pulling for her so hard? Dang! Bravo, Ms DuMaurier!
